前言
平时在一直在linux/unix下工作,早已经习惯使用vim编辑文本。在windows虽然也有众多的编辑器,但用的不顺溜。所以windows下也需要个vim。
gvim安装
- 安装gvim
- 运行下载的安装程序,并按照说明一步一步正确安装即可
我这里安装的路径是 D:\Program Files (x86)\Vim
简要配置
- 配置环境变量
- 配置vim参数 在D:\Program Files (x86)\Vim\_vimrc最后加入
colorscheme desert "配色方案
syntax enable "打开语法高亮
syntax on "打开语法高亮
gvim默认Ctrl+f是弹出搜索,而linux下Ctrl+f是下翻。按下面方法修改 修改D:\Program Files (x86)\Vim\vim80\mswin.vim注释下面代码
"if has("gui")
" " CTRL-F is the search dialog
" noremap <C-F> :promptfind<CR>
" inoremap <C-F> <C-\><C-O>:promptfind<CR>
" cnoremap <C-F> <C-\><C-C>:promptfind<CR>
"
" " CTRL-H is the replace dialog
" noremap <C-H> :promptrepl<CR>
" inoremap <C-H> <C-\><C-O>:promptrepl<CR>
" cnoremap <C-H> <C-\><C-C>:promptrepl<CR>
"endif
更多详细配置参考
技巧分享
- 删除空行
:g/^$/d
(’d’后面有个空格) - 删除空行以及只有空格的行
:g/^\s*$/d
(’d’后面有个空格) - 删除/* */注释
:%s!\s*/\*\_.\{-}\*/\s*! !g
- 去掉所有的“//”注释
:%s!\s*//.*!!
- 转成十六进制显示
:%!xxd
- 十六进制转回正常显示
:%!xxd -r
更多技巧请看vim 正则表达式